Case Summary: In SLP(C) No. 7803/2005, Oriental Bank of Commerce & Others challenged a Delhi High Court judgment dated 14/01/2005 (LPA No. 37/2005) before the Supreme Court. After hearing counsel for both parties on 25/04/2005, the bench of Justice Ruma Pal and Justice C.K. Thakker dismissed the special leave petition, upholding the High Court's decision and ending the Bank's appeal.
